centos7用yum只下载不安装软件及其依赖,然后离线安装到其他机器上

文章讲述了如何用yum在线下载好rpm包,然后在其他机器上离线安装一个录屏工具vcl

找一台全新的centos7 可以是虚拟机。

--downloadonly#只下载
--downloaddir=temp#rpm的下载保存地址

用命令:

yum install https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m
yum install --downloadonly --downloaddir=temp https://download1.rpmfusion.org/free/el/rpmfusion-free-release-7.noarch.rpm
yum install --downloadonly --downloaddir=temp vlc
yum install --downloadonly --downloaddir=temp vlc-core
yum install --downloadonly --downloaddir=temp python-vlc npapi-vlc 

在tmp下看到下载的录屏软件及其依赖,然后放到新机器上

安装rpm包 :

强制安装一次: rpm -ivh --force --nodeps *.rpm
再次执行: rpm -ivh *.rpm

没问题就ok。

如果有问题就到找缺失的相关依赖镜像

镜像网址之一:https://centos.pkgs.org/

如果你真的需要一个录屏软件的话,我把需要的rpm已经打包好了,地址:

https://download.csdn.net/download/dpnice/10510542

安装完成在应用程序影音下面可以看到vlc软件。

离线安装其他软件都是一样的道理。

rpm命令:http://man.linuxde.net/rpm

yum命令:http://man.linuxde.net/yum



你可能感兴趣的:(linux)